Output 74b81fce3b3e406a35ed4fc7ebd8a420407ece8451aa38d86e4e304de27b5b0d:54

value
126879
script pubkey
OP_0 OP_PUSHBYTES_20 bf25d4c358438305d557f8c526b206d7b4135d50
address
bc1qhujafs6cgwpst42hlrzjdvsx676pxh2s4rmuz8
transaction
74b81fce3b3e406a35ed4fc7ebd8a420407ece8451aa38d86e4e304de27b5b0d
spent
true